How sticky are ping leaves?

I got a P. x weser today, and it's the very first time I've ever seen a Ping in real life. However, to my surprise, the Ping leaves weren't sticky at all to my touch! I mean, sundews are quite sticky when I've accidentally touched them, but my Ping seems non-sticky at all! Is there a problem or is this normal? I understand that Pings produce winter non-carnivorous leaves, but the leaves on mine seem pretty big.
 
It's normal. My primuliflora's leaves feel like butter, too. Not sticky at all. But, for some reason, they're sticky to bugs

Pings feel more greasy/buttery than sticky. But it has enough adhesion to grab the little bugs. Thats how they got their name..."little greasy one" (pinguicula).
